Yes, a 2-year-old can fly first class, but airlines often have their own policies regarding seating arrangements for young children. Parents are advised to check with the specific airline for their first-class seating policy towards toddlers to ensure a comfortable and safe journey.

  1. Can toddlers sit in first class on airplanes? Yes, toddlers can sit in first class, but seating policies vary by airline. Parents should check with their specific airline to confirm any restrictions or requirements.
  2. Do airlines charge extra for toddlers flying in first class? Generally, airlines require a purchased seat for toddlers flying first class, which may come at an adult fare. Policies on lap infants and charges vary between airlines.
  3. What should parents know about flying first class with a 2-year-old? Parents should review the airline’s first-class seating policy for children, bring appropriate entertainment and snacks, and ensure safety compliance for a comfortable flight.
